Joanna Jedrzejczyk and Colby Covington are teammates at American Top Team, but when ‘Chaos’ fights Kamaru Usman at UFC 245 for the title, she will be rooting for Usman.

Why the former strawweight champion will do so is because of how Covington has treated their ATT teammates like Dustin Poirier and Jorge Masvidal.

“No, no focus on dumb people,” Joanna Jedrzejczyk said on Ariel Helwani’s MMA Show (via BJPENN.com). “Colby is something else. We let him be. We let him be.

“I never wish any fighter to get like hurt, I wish that Usman will beat his ass. I shouldn’t say this because you always should support your people, but Colby is not a friend, he’s just acting weird. He’s an ugly guy,” she continued. “You never talk bad about your teammates, doesn’t matter if you like them or not.”

Recently, Colby Covington and Jorge Masvidal had a falling out after being best friends for years. ‘Gamebred’ said it was because ‘Chaos’ failed to pay one of his coaches.

Meanwhile, Covington picked Khabib Nurmagomedov to beat Dustin Poirier and said he couldn’t stuff a takedown. So, according to Joanna Jedrzejczyk, she believes this is all an act and he is trying to be like Conor McGregor.

“He’s acting like he’s Conor McGregor. Trying to show on the video that people open the door for him, that he’s driving fancy cars,” Jedrzejczyk said. “He’s in show guys, he’s in [the show]. He’s a hard worker. I don’t buy it.”

Joanna Jedrzejczyk’s upcoming fight with Michelle Waterson is still taking place as planned, at least according to the former champion.

Jedrzejczyk meets Waterson in a strawweight headliner at UFC Tampa this Saturday. However, recent reports suggested the fight was in jeopardy as Jedrzejczyk reportedly informed the UFC a couple of days ago that she would unable to make the 116-pound weight limit.

The report added that Waterson was offered the opportunity to fight the Pole at a catchweight, only for it to be declined. This led to speculation that Jedrzejczyk may be replaced with a different opponent.

However, the former strawweight queen provided an update on Wednesday. She also posted a picture of herself smiling as she was cutting weight, seemingly implying that the fight is still on:

???? #staycalm #everythingisfine ? @oshee_world ?? #ufctampa #fightweek #oshee,” she wrote in an Instagram post.

Jedrzejczyk has never missed weight before, but has notably struggled with the cut to 115 especially when she was the champion. This will also be her first fight in the division since losing her rematch to Rose Namajunas back in April 2018.

Though she was disappointed at not getting a title shot, Michelle Waterson has the consolation of facing the former champion in Joanna Jedrzejczyk.

Waterson was recently announced as the headliner for UFC Tampa opposite Jedrzejczyk. However, there was initial talk that the fight would headline a UFC event in San Francisco. In the end, it was announced that Tampa would be the location for the strawweight headliner. Waterson, however, doesn’t know why the location was changed:

“You know what? Honestly, I don’t know,” she said of why the location was changed on Ariel Helwani’s MMA Show on Monday. “I don’t know if they were working on trying to get that arena put together. Either way, I’m still very excited that the UFC put us on for a main event and I’m stoked.”

Waterson Had Her Eye On Jedrzejczyk

Waterson was previously campaigning for a title shot against champion Jessica Andrade. Instead, Weili Zhang was given the opportunity. Still, “The Karate Hottie” believes her fight with Jedrzejczyk is a championship fight on its own because of the latter’s legacy:

“I don’t know [why I didn’t get the title shot] and I might have stressed about it for a day but things like that are out of my control,” she explained. “Since I was signed to the UFC, I’ve had my eye on Joanna because she was the longest-reigning champ and when I was signed, she was the champ. So it would be my honor to be able to fight her in a five round fight and in my opinion, this is a championship fight.

“Yeah, obviously I was disappointed [in not getting the title shot] but the truth is, the strawweight division is a very stacked division. I think that Weili, I don’t think many people know about Weili, but she’s definitely a contender and I’m looking forward to watching that fight. The more people that the champ gets to fight, the better it is for me so then I can watch them fight and I have more time to scout them out. I understand everything happens for a reason and this is my journey and I’m just going to ride at the best way I know how.”

UFC Tampa takes place October 12 at the Amalie Arena.

A women’s strawweight bout between Joanna Jedrzejczyk and Michelle Waterson is official and set to headline the UFC’s return to Tampa.

The fight was previously reported to be in the works last month, though no location was set at the time. However, it was announced by the promotion on Friday that it would take place October 12 at the Amalie Arena in Tampa, Florida. Tickets are set to go on sale later this month.

Jedrzejczyk has gone 1-3 in her last four fights, having most recently suffered a unanimous decision defeat to Valentina Shevchenko for the vacant women’s flyweight title. She will now return to her natural weight class as she looks to regain her title.

As for Waterson, she has won three fights in a row and a win over the former champion could all but guarantee her getting the next crack at the title.

UFC Tampa will also see the return of Mackenzie Dern, who faces Amanda Ribas in a strawweight bout. Dern last competed at UFC 222 in March last year but has spent time away from the Octagon after giving birth to her daughter. Also on the cards is a flyweight bout between top contender Deiveson Figueiredo and Timothy Elliott.
